I've uploaded my project approximately 12 days ago, February 16, and it still isn't indexed. It is a paid project with adult content, I've read all the guidelines in the "Getting your game indexed", it says it can take some business days but 12 days is a lot, I've also tried sending an e-mail to the support but got no answer yet.
There's some stuff in the FAQ that can get a game unindexed, I'd be pleased to know if I did violate any of those things and hence my game got unindexed, or if it's just taking a while for my game to be checked by the itch.io team.
Best regards, SX Cells Studios.